This paper analyzes recent trends in and alternative projections of the supply, demand, and trade for roots and tubers (R and T). In doing so, it seeks to provide a clearer vision of the contribution that these crops can make to the food systems of developing countries through the year 2020. A key objective of this paper is to clarify and, as much as possible, to quantify the complexity and magnitude of that contribution.
